Associate Rural Chartered Surveyor – Shrewsbury / Towcester - Competitive salary + Benefits


The Job:

This is a strategic hire to grow and strengthen rural surveying services in Shrewsbury and the surrounding region. You will act as the internal lead for rural surveying, providing technical expertise, supporting colleagues, and delivering complex rural estate strategies. The role combines hands‑on project delivery with team development, business growth, and the evolution of the rural and agency offering, ensuring work aligns with RICS standards, agricultural policy, and environmental legislation.


Key Responsibilities:

* Lead rural surveying projects and provide expert advice on estate strategies, tenancy matters, and asset optimisation
* Act as the primary technical contact within the office for colleagues and clients
* Mentor and support team members, sharing knowledge and building capability
* Ensure all work meets professional standards and regulatory requirements
* Identify and develop new business opportunities, strengthening professional networks
* Drive regional growth and enhance market presence across Shropshire and surrounding areas
* Support the evolution and diversification of rural and agency services
* Represent the business at industry events, reinforcing its profile and reputation
* Contribute to improving efficiency, productivity, and overall profitability


The Company:

An opportunity has arisen to join a well‑established, multi‑disciplinary property and land consultancy in their Shrewsbury office. The business offers the scale to provide diverse project opportunities while maintaining a close‑knit environment that encourages autonomy, professional growth, and strong internal relationships. You will be part of a collaborative development team comprising engineers, surveyors, planners, architects, and other specialists, delivering a broad and varied workload across rural and land consultancy services.


The Candidate:

* Accomplished and commercially astute rural surveying professional
* Proven people management and team‑building skills, able to inspire and support colleagues
* Strong commercial awareness, with the ability to turn market trends into practical, results‑driven strategies
* Deep knowledge of rural property law, agricultural economics, and sustainability practices
* Proven track record in rural strategy and consultancy
* Expertise in valuation and development appraisal
* Excellent client care and relationship management skills
* Confident decision‑making and problem‑solving, resilient and adaptable in a fast‑paced environment
* MRICS‑accredited degree or equivalent professional qualification
* Comfortable using social media (LinkedIn, Facebook, Twitter) for professional engagement and brand presence
* Full, clean UK driving licence with regular travel between sites and client meetings


The Package:

* Friendly and supportive team with genuine opportunities for professional development and career progression
* Competitive salary reflective of skills, qualifications, and experience
* Funded professional memberships, CPD events, and time off for approved training
* Private healthcare through BUPA and Employee Assistance Programme, including health plan and annual flu vaccination
* Flexible, agile working approach with a mix of remote and office‑based work
* 35 days’ annual leave (pro rata, including bank holidays) plus an extra day for your birthday and additional days for long service (one extra day every 3 years)
* Discretionary bonus scheme
* Enhanced workplace pension scheme via NEST
* Access to employee loans and discounts on company services (after probation)
* Salary sacrifice schemes, including Electric Vehicle and Cycle to Work options
